[1840–50; ‹ NL, equiv. to a-6 + geus- (var. s. of Gk geúesthai to taste) + -ia-y3]This word is first recorded in the period 1840–50. Other words that entered Englishat around the same time include: flan, layout, organizer, plaque, striation
